Is the USA still worth it for Indian students in 2026+?

 

. USA Still Offers World-Class Education and Career Value

Academic & Professional Prestige:
• U.S. universities remain among the world’s strongest in research, innovation, and global reputation. A degree from top U.S. institutions often carries lifelong value. Eleevate Overseas

Post-Study Work Options:
• OPT (Optional Practical Training) + STEM OPT still allow up to 3 years of work after graduation, especially in STEM fields like CS, engineering, data science, biotech — a major reason many choose the U.S. Eleevate Overseas+1

Networking & Exposure:
• Strong campus networks, internships, company connections, and exposure to cutting-edge industries aren’t easily replicated in many other countries. foredoverseas.com

πŸ“Š Despite challenges, Indian students remain the largest group on U.S. campuses, showing continued demand. The Times of India


⚠️ 2. Real Challenges Today (Especially Visa & Immigration)

Visa and Immigration Uncertainty:
• Recent U.S. visa policy changes have increased interview wait times, caused cancellations and revocations, and added scrutiny — making the process more unpredictable for Indian students. The Times of India+1

OPT & H-1B Pathway Is Unstable:
• Proposed changes — like higher H-1B fees and potential tightening of OPT — have created confusion and may reduce job sponsorship opportunities after graduation. Home+1

Enrollment Trends Shifting:
• Newly enrolled international students in the U.S. dropped ~17%, largely due to visa policy changes. Reuters

Mixed On-the-Ground Sentiment:
• Many students report stress around job hunting, layoff impacts, and uncertainty about immigration pathways — real stories from peers reflect this tough landscape. Reddit+1


πŸ’° 3. Cost vs. Return — Higher Than Ever

High Costs:
• Tuition + living expenses in the U.S. remain very high (often >₹40–60 lakh/yr). Careers360

ROI Remains Strong for Some:
• Graduates in tech and STEM often land high-paying jobs (e.g., ~$90K–130K+), which can still make the investment worthwhile if you secure employment. Eleevate Overseas

πŸ”Ή But if you don’t find a job or H-1B sponsorship after OPT, the financial picture becomes far less compelling.


🌍 4. More Global Options Mean More Choices

Countries like Canada, UK, Germany, Ireland, UAE, Australia are increasingly attractive alternatives because they offer:

✨ Easier visa processing
✨ Longer post-study work permits (e.g., Canada’s PGWP)
✨ Lower cost of living and tuition (e.g., Germany)
✨ Growing job markets abroad Careers360+1

So the U.S. is no longer the default “best” choice for everyone — it depends on what you want.


🎯 5. When the USA Is Worth It

Your priority is top-tier education and research.
You’re targeting high-growth fields (CS, AI, biotech, data) with strong U.S. industry demand.
You can financially sustain at least 2–3 years without immediate job outcomes.
You’re prepared for the immigration complexity and competition.

In this scenario, the U.S. still offers significant ROI and global career prospects. Eleevate Overseas+1


🎯 When It Might Not Be Worth It

❌ If your goal is mainly to settle long-term in the U.S. — immigration pathways are much harder than before, and there’s no guarantee after OPT.
❌ If you cannot comfortably afford U.S. costs without financial stress.
❌ If you want career certainty soon after graduation — alternatives like Canada often provide clearer paths.


🧠 Final Bottom Line

GoalIs USA Worth It?
Top-tier education & global credentials⭐ Yes
Tech/STEM jobs after graduation⭐ Possible, but not guaranteed
Permanent settlement⚠️ Difficult, uncertain
Cost-efficient & predictable path⚠️ Mixed; other countries might be better

Conclusion: The U.S. is still worth it for Indian students — if you make an informed choice aligned with your goals and risks. It’s no longer a guaranteed golden ticket, but it still offers world-class opportunities that are hard to get elsewhere if you’re aiming high in STEM and research fields.
